Peril - Answer--Something that causes a loss. Hazard - Answer--Something that increases the probability that a loss will occur. Warranty - Answer--A policy condition, either based on information in ... the insureds application or inserted by the insurer. It is a guarantee of a fact. Misrepresentation - Answer--An untrue statement by the insured, made in an application for insurance but which does not become a part of the policy. Concealment - Answer--The failure of the insured to reveal relevant facts known to the insured in applying for insurance Personal Contract - Answer--Policies cover people who own and operate things, such as automobiles. Conditional Contract - Answer--Also called a hypothetical contract, is a contract agreement that only requires performance once the delineated conditions are met. This legal agreement requires prior performance of another agreement or clause in order to be enforceable. If the other agreement or condition is performed, then the conditional contract is enforceable and the parties are bound to carry out the terms of the contract. Contract of Indemnity - Answer--Principle of insurance that provides that when a loss occurs, the insured should be restored to the approximate financial condition he/she occupied before the loss occurred, no better or no worse. Insurable Interest - Answer--the reasonable concern of a person to obtain insurance for any individual or property against unforeseen events such as death, losses, etc. Waiver - Answer--1.)
